Best Surfaces for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ters work best on flat and stable surfaces.

Ideal surfaces:

  • Sidewalks

  • Pavements

  • Shopping areas

  • Smooth roads

Acceptable (with caution):

  • Grass

  • Gravel paths

  • Slight slopes

Avoid:

  • Muddy or wet terrain

  • Steep hills

  • Uneven or rocky surfaces

Choosing a scooter with a stable structure and durable tires makes a big difference in outdoor performance.


How Weather Affects Outdoor Use

Weather conditions play an important role when using a mobility scooter outdoors.

Sunny weather

Ideal for outdoor use. Provides the best visibility and safest riding conditions.

Rainy weather

Use caution. Wet surfaces may reduce traction and control.

Windy conditions

Strong winds can affect stability, especially for lightweight scooters.

Cold weather

Battery performance may decrease slightly in very low temperatures.

Tip: Always check weather conditions before heading out.


Key Features for Outdoor Mobility Scooters

If you plan to use your scooter outdoors regularly, look for these essential features:

Long Battery Range

A higher-capacity battery allows you to travel farther without worrying about running out of power.

Solid Tires (Flat-Free)

Solid tires are ideal for outdoor use because they:

  • Don’t puncture

  • Require no maintenance

  • Provide stable performance

Stable Frame

A strong frame ensures better balance and safety on uneven surfaces.

Detachable Battery

A removable battery makes it easier to charge at home after outdoor use.


Safety Tips for Outdoor Riding

  • Always start at a low speed

  • Avoid sudden turns or stops

  • Use sidewalks whenever possible

  • Keep both hands on the controls

  • Stay visible to others

Safety and control are key to enjoying outdoor mobility.


Choosing the Right Scooter for Outdoor Use

When selecting a mobility scooter for outdoor use, consider your daily routine:

  • Short trips → standard battery is sufficient

  • Longer outdoor rides → extended battery is better

  • Uneven surfaces → prioritize stability and tires

The right combination of range, comfort, and safety features will give you the best experience.
